Output ef3d3fe70aeca9c49772f8f66a1910d90f0862db4f5646246439b1f1a1066b07:0

value
50856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26640f36b94d544eb4b42c3b131976a480b7399e OP_EQUAL
address
35C1U5qqx96xgoGYAQagUm1uE1TM4zS42j
transaction
ef3d3fe70aeca9c49772f8f66a1910d90f0862db4f5646246439b1f1a1066b07